Abstract:A novel dipeptide, (β‐aspartylglycine (β‐DG), has been isolated from tissues of the marine gastropod molluscAplysia californica.This compound was detected only inAplysiaand not in other molluscs, such asHelixorMercenaria, or in lobster or frog. Among theAplysiatissues, the highest levels of β‐DG were in nervous tissue and in the reproductive tract. β‐DG was assayed by HPLC as theo‐phthaldialdehyde derivative and found to be present in all individual, identified neurons at a concentration of approximately 40 pmol/μg protein. The peptide was identified as β‐DG by gas chromatography‐mass spectrometry (GCMS) using trimethylsilyl derivatives prepared before and after acid hydrolysis. It was further characterized as the β‐isomer by TLC, including Rf, atypical blue‐gray color with ninhydrin, and a violet color with Cu2+‐ninhydrin. A fractionation scheme is described whereby acid‐soluble tissue constituents can be divided into acidic, neutral, and basic components using mini ion‐exchange columns.
